Pneumatic tank trucks—also known as dry bulk tank trucks or powder tanker trucks—are essential vehicles for transporting bulk materials such as cement, flour, lime, fly ash, and plastic pellets. These trucks use compressed air systems to load and unload materials efficiently, making them a critical solution in industries like construction, food processing, and chemical manufacturing.

The Tank: Structure and Material Design

The tank body is the central component of a pneumatic tank truck. It is specifically engineered to store and discharge dry bulk materials under pressure.

Key Materials Used

At CSCTRUCK China Tank Truck, pneumatic tanks are typically manufactured using:

  • Aluminum alloy – lightweight, corrosion-resistant, and fuel-efficient
  • Carbon steel – durable and cost-effective for heavy-duty applications
  • Stainless steel – ideal for food-grade or chemical transport

The choice of material depends on the cargo type, operating environment, and customer requirements.

Structural Design

Most pneumatic tank trucks feature a cylindrical tank with a conical bottom. This design is critical for efficient unloading because it allows gravity to direct materials toward the discharge outlet.

Some advanced designs include:

  • V-shaped tanks for improved discharge efficiency
  • Multi-compartment tanks for transporting different materials
  • Low center-of-gravity structures for better road stability

Internal Aeration System

Inside the tank, fluidization pads (aeration membranes) are installed. These pads inject compressed air into the material, reducing internal friction and turning solid particles into a fluid-like state.

This process ensures:

  • Faster unloading
  • Minimal material residue
  • Reduced pipeline blockage

The Compressor: Powering Material Flow

The air compressor system is the heart of the pneumatic tank truck’s unloading mechanism. It generates the compressed air needed to move bulk materials through the system.

Types of Compressors

CSCTRUCK China Tank Truck pneumatic tank trucks are equipped with:

  • Rotary screw compressors – high efficiency, continuous airflow, and long service life
  • Rotary vane compressors – compact, reliable, and cost-effective

Among these, rotary screw compressors are the most widely used in modern bulk transport fleets.

Power Source Options

Compressors can be powered in different ways:

  • PTO (Power Take-Off) from the truck engine
  • Independent diesel engine
  • Electric motor (for stationary or specialized use)

The PTO system is the most common, offering simplicity and lower operational cost.

Working Principle

During unloading:

  1. The compressor generates high-pressure air (1.5–3 bar)
  2. Air is directed into the tank through aeration systems
  3. Bulk materials become fluidized
  4. Air pressure pushes materials through pipelines to storage silos

The Valves: Controlling Flow and Safety

Valves are essential for controlling both airflow and material discharge in a pneumatic tank truck system. They ensure precision, efficiency, and operational safety.

Main Types of Valves

1. Discharge Valves

These valves control the release of materials from the tank into the discharge pipeline. They are designed to handle abrasive materials like cement and sand.

2. Aeration Valves

Aeration valves regulate the amount of compressed air entering the tank. Proper airflow ensures effective fluidization and smooth unloading.

3. Pressure Relief Valves

Safety is critical in pressurized systems. Pressure relief valves automatically release excess pressure to prevent tank damage or accidents.

4. Check Valves

Check valves prevent backflow of air or materials, protecting the compressor and maintaining system stability.

5. Butterfly and Ball Valves

These valves provide quick shut-off and easy flow control, commonly used in discharge and pipeline systems.

Integrated System: How Tanks, Compressors, and Valves Work Together

The true efficiency of a pneumatic tank truck lies in the integration of its components.

Here’s how the system works as a whole:

  1. The compressor generates compressed air
  2. The valves regulate airflow into the tank
  3. The tank’s aeration system fluidizes the material
  4. The discharge valves control material output

This coordinated process allows materials to be transported over long distances and unloaded into elevated silos quickly and efficiently.
